This played out on Twitter yesterday and today. I'm posting some of the tweets because David Crisp may not have found a nurse mare in time if it hadn't been for Twitter. Stories like this happen every foaling season. It was a lot harder to find good matches for orphan foals before Twitter.

I have been up for more than 48 hours so no eloquence in my words but thankfulness in my heart. Most of you know we lost Wave The Colors on Sunday night due to colon torsion and emergency surgery. She left us with so many great memories and an 8 week old Goldencents colt (1/2)
13h13 hours ago
Our Goldencents foal was grieving so hard after suddenly losing his Mom, and would not drink for us from bucket or bottle. He was inconsolable. We knew we needed a nurse mare but could not find one within several hundred miles of us. That’s when @SarahHorsegirl stepped in (2/3)
13h13 hours ago
Sarah’s lead in Aubrey, Texas resulted in us finding Misty K., whose mare had lost her own foal over the weekend, and Jackie J., an orphan foal specialist, and Dr Holtmeyer. Together we came up with a plan to get our foal to Misty’s mare, appropriately named Hope! (3/4)
13h13 hours ago
Our 700 mile odyssey began by picking up our foal upon release from the hospital and hauling him to meet Hope. Walter, a good friend, pitched in and offered to drive so I could ride in the trailer with Goldie & try to console him. By about 10 pm we arrived at Jackie’s farm (4/5)
13h13 hours ago
Jackie immediately put Hope and Goldie in a special stall to facilitate a safe nursing environment for a young hungry foal and a grieving older mare. Literally within minutes Goldie was getting a tummy full of milk! We watched as for over an hour Goldie continued to nurse (5/6)
